A growing conversation is brewing around advice to acquire a modest amount of Bitcoin. While some are excited, many voice concerns over the risks tied to what they see as questionable claims.
The proposition that accumulating 0.1 BTC is the golden ticket to financial success has set off a mix of reactions among the crypto community. On forums, some commenters express disbelief, questioning the soundness of such advice. Reactions range from outright sarcasm to serious caution, reflecting a broader debate on investment strategies in the ever-fluctuating crypto market.
One user quipped, "Please tell me where you got your crystal ball from," indicating distrust in overly optimistic claims. Another lamented, "It's fomo spam. You plaster this around, and dumb people start buying." This skepticism suggests that many believe the post could mislead inexperienced investors.
With prices constantly changing, those advocating for Bitcoin investments need to tread carefully. The financial implications of investing in such volatile assets may not be clearly understood by all. As one commenter pointed out, "It will only cost BTC to find out." This hint at possible regret highlights the risks associated with impulsive buying.
The overall sentiment reflects wariness. Notably, users are questioning both the motives behind aggressive buying strategies and the validity of these claims.

Reflecting on the late 1990s, when countless individuals jumped onto the tech bandwagon, we find a relevant comparison. Many believed acquiring shares in every tech startup would dish out infinite returns, similar to today's impulse toward accumulating Bitcoin. Yet, when the dot-com bubble burst, only companies with solid fundamentals survived. The current crypto landscape mirrors this, where speculation can overshadow sound investment strategiesβa reminder that chasing trends can lead to unforeseen consequences, highlighting the need for discernment in any financial venture.
